Cómo hacer clic en un enlace aleatorio de los resultados de búsqueda de Google a través de Selenium y Python

Actualmente usando Selenium + Python y este código:

browser.get('http://www.google.com')
search = browser.find_element_by_name('q')
search.send_keys("how to search the internet")
search.send_keys(Keys.RETURN) # hit return after you enter search text
time.sleep(5) # sleep for 5 seconds so you can see the results
browser.execute_script("window.scrollTo(0, 873)") 
time.sleep(2)
browser.find_element(By.XPATH, '(//h3)[3]/a').click()`

como mi código.

Qué sucede: va a Google y escribe las palabras y busca la búsqueda. Se desplaza hacia abajo un poco y luego hace clic en el primer enlace

Lo que quiero: quiero poder hacer clic en un enlace aleatorio desde la página de resultados de búsqueda

¿Como hacer esto

Edit: Esto es lo que quise decir cuando dije innecesario: Innecesario 1:https: //imgur.com/a/70qz89

Innecesario 2:https: //imgur.com/a/8WWvcn

Estos son los únicos resultados que quiero: Esto:https: //imgur.com/a/eTatFV

Respuestas a la pregunta(1)

Su respuesta a la pregunta